First up, Molly breaks down some news stories, including Meta's ad troubles in Europe (1:24) and Semafor's saga with its climate editor departing. (9:51) Then, Jason answers questions from founders! (20:25) Finally, Producer Rachel joins Molly to discuss what happened with Hive Social. (32:10)
(0:00) Molly tees up today's segments!
(1:24) Molly covers Meta's targeted ad troubles in Europe - are we headed for a new standard for ad-based business models?

(9:51) Breaking down Semafor parting ways with its climate editor and a major crypto lending business is stopping its US operations

(20:25) Ask Jason! What percentage of equity should a startup give to an advisor?
(27:22) Ask Jason! General advice for founders pitching investors?
(29:31) Ask Jason! In this environment, should early-stage startups focus on profitability from day one?
(32:10) Rachel Reporting: Molly and Producer Rachel break down what happened with Hive Social and discuss broadcast platforms vs consumption platforms
